Output 59ab43e6d4b51f7d40c49238458ad34a3212bba8b253d7892914739a3382e6bb:1

value
124538
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7d0c4821548da1b2849a15dd0077557910f5248b5416bd3dfc6c676cb799eecd
address
bc1p05xysg253ksm9py6zhwsqa640yg02fyt2stt600ud3nkedueamxszzp77l
transaction
59ab43e6d4b51f7d40c49238458ad34a3212bba8b253d7892914739a3382e6bb
spent
true